Access is the largest privately-held records and information management (RIM) services provider worldwide, with operations across the United States, Canada, Central and South America. Access helps companies manage and activate their critical business information to make them more efficient and more compliant through offsite storage and information governance services, scanning and digital transformation solutions, document management software including CartaHR, and secure destruction services. Primary Functions:
  • Responsible for primary and back-up driving responsibilities on all routes, by providing effective and timely delivery and pick-up of client materials in accordance with company policy and customer requirements.
  • Responsible for loading, unloading material and media as required, at both company and client locations with the use of flatbeds and hand trucks.
  • Utilize handheld bar code scanner and related PC as required with inventory systems.
  • Utilize mobile equipment in a safe and practical manner following company policies and standards.
  • Ensure that all driver paperwork is submitted accurately, legibly and on-time each day.
  • Ensure that PDT Communicate & Process steps are completed daily for all Assigned Work Orders.
  • Handle all physical requirements for loading, unloading, transporting & driving without assistance.
  • Maintain a clean and organized vehicle, pursuant to company standards.
  • Interact professionally with all clients.
  • Communicate regularly with your direct supervisor to notify him or her of any potential issues, including but not limited to those relating to your job, or those relating to the client.

Physical Requirements (lifting, etc.):
  • Routine lifting of 20-60 pounds (100-500 containers per day).
  • Grip, lift, push, pull, and carry wheeled, plastic bins over, up and down inclines, stairs, changes in walking surfaces and elevations.
  • Overhead reaching.
  • Routine bending and stretching.
  • Routine pushing and pulling.
  • Climb/step into a truck or cab.
